For the 2026 school year, there are 3 alternative public elementary schools serving 574 students in Arkansas.
The top-ranked alternative public elementary schools in Arkansas are Hope Academy Of Public Service, Cabot Panther Academy and Belle Point Alternative Center.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Arkansas alternative public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 28% (versus the Arkansas public elementary school average of 45%), and reading proficiency score of 41%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the Arkansas public elementary school average of 43% (majority Black).
